James Outhouse, 71, of rural Beecher City, died at 11:41 p.m. Thursday, July 1, 2021 at his home.

James was born on Saturday, April 29, 1950 in Vandalia to Lee and Catherine (Payne) Outhouse. He had been an over-the-road truck driver and had been employed with the Patoka Pipeline. He was a member of the Masonic Lodge #533, Altamont and a past member of the NRA.

He is survived by 2 nieces and his adopted grandchildren.

Jim was preceded in death by his parents, special friend, Erma Fair and 2 sisters.

As per his wishes there will be no services. Burial will be at Pleasant Grove Cemetery, Moccasin at a later date. Memorials may be made to the donor’s choice. Gieseking Funeral Home, Altamont is assisting the family with arrangements. Online condolences may be expressed by clicking here
